Minimalism
Minimalism is about more than owning fewer items; it is a mindset. It focuses on eliminating excess, embracing functionality, and appreciating quality over quantity. A minimalist approach to fashion means owning pieces that serve multiple purposes, are timeless, and make you feel confident without unnecessary clutter.
Similarly, a minimalist lifestyle is about simplifying daily routines, decluttering living spaces, and prioritizing experiences over possessions. The connection between minimalist fashion and lifestyle is strong, as each supports the other in creating a more meaningful, less stressful life.

Building a Minimalist Wardrobe
Creating a minimalist wardrobe involves careful planning.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
Step 1: Assess Your Current Wardrobe
Evaluate what you already own. Keep only items you wear regularly or that hold sentimental value. Donate or sell what you don’t need. Ask yourself if each piece is versatile, functional, and high-quality.
Step 2: Choose a Color Palette
Select neutral or complementary colors to maximize outfit combinations. Black, white, gray, beige, and navy are staples. These colors ensure every piece pairs well, including your Rudsak Canada outerwear.
Step 3: Invest in Key Pieces
Focus on quality essentials: a tailored blazer, a leather jacket, comfortable shoes, and classic shirts. Opt for brands known for durability, such as Rudsak Canada, which offers premium jackets and accessories.
Step 4: Prioritize Versatility
Each item should serve multiple purposes. A minimalist wardrobe allows you to transition from work to casual events seamlessly.
Step 5: Maintain Your Wardrobe
Proper care extends the life of your clothes. Store items correctly, clean them as recommended, and repair minor damages promptly.

Common Misconceptions About Minimalism
Minimalism is often misunderstood. Let’s address a few misconceptions:
Minimalism Means Owning Very Little
Not true. Minimalism is about intentionality, not deprivation. You can own plenty of items, as long as each serves a purpose and aligns with your values.
Minimalism Is Boring
Minimalist fashion can be stylish and expressive. Simplicity enhances creativity by focusing on quality, texture, and design.
Minimalism Is Only for the Wealthy
While quality items may cost more upfront, minimalism reduces long-term spending. Anyone can adopt a minimalist mindset by prioritizing needs over wants.
